The invention relates to a high-voltage cable turning radius measuring tool. Its main technical characteristics are: it includes a horizontal ruler and an elastic rod, the fixed end of the elastic rod is fastened with one end of the elastic rod, and the movable end of the elastic rod is installed movably. In the slideway formed on the surface of the horizontal ruler, when the moving end of the elastic rod is subjected to an external force towards the fixed end, the elastic rod will naturally form a circular arc with a changing radius. The invention provides a tool for directly measuring the turning radius of a high-voltage cable, which connects a horizontal ruler engraved with the turning radius with an elastic rod, and makes the elastic rod coincide with the high-voltage cable by applying an external force on the moving end of the elastic rod The arc of the cable can be obtained by directly reading the scale at the intersection of the horizontal ruler and the elastic rod to obtain the turning radius of the cable arc. It has high measurement accuracy, is easy to use, and has a wide range of measurement.

背景技术 Background technique
在高压电缆的敷设过程中,应该严格按照国家标准及相关规定执行,以保证高压电缆发挥正常的功能。按照国家标准,高压电缆在敷设过程中,其转弯半径不应小于其直径D的20倍。目前,尚未有对高压电缆转弯半径进行直接测量的工具,通常的测量方法是需要提前测量电缆直径,再使用钢板制作相应直径的圆弧形靠尺,最后在施工现场使用圆弧形靠尺进行测量,其测量方法非常不便,且测量精度较低。 During the laying process of high-voltage cables, national standards and relevant regulations should be strictly followed to ensure the normal function of high-voltage cables. According to national standards, during the laying process of high-voltage cables, their turning radius should not be less than 20 times their diameter D. At present, there is no tool for direct measurement of the turning radius of high-voltage cables. The usual measurement method is to measure the diameter of the cable in advance, and then use a steel plate to make an arc-shaped ruler of the corresponding diameter, and finally use the arc-shaped ruler on the construction site. Measurement, the measurement method is very inconvenient, and the measurement accuracy is low. the

下面结合图2说明本发明的测量原理。图中,x为水平直尺的长度,l为圆弧长度,r为转弯半径,则水平直尺的长度x满足以下公式: The measurement principle of the present invention will be described below in conjunction with FIG. 2 . In the figure, x is the length of the horizontal ruler, l is the length of the arc, and r is the turning radius, then the length x of the horizontal ruler satisfies the following formula:
由上式可以得到转弯半径r为: From the above formula, the turning radius r can be obtained as:
从而准确地计算出电缆弧线的转弯半径。 Thereby accurately calculating the turning radius of the cable arc. the
为了直观地测量电缆转弯半径,可以将上述电缆转弯半径r的计算值刻在水平直尺上,形成刻有电缆转弯半径的水平直尺,其测量范围可从某一值至无穷大。 In order to intuitively measure the cable turning radius, the calculated value of the above cable turning radius r can be engraved on a horizontal ruler to form a horizontal ruler engraved with the cable turning radius, and its measurement range can be from a certain value to infinity. the
在现场使用时,将高压电缆转弯半径测量工具的固定端固定在高压电缆上,通过水平调节移动端在水平直尺上的位置使弹性杆与高压电缆的弯曲度重合,读取水平直尺上与弹性杆移动端相交点处的刻度,即可直接得到电缆的转弯半径,其测量方法简单,且测量范围广泛。 When used in the field, fix the fixed end of the high-voltage cable turning radius measurement tool on the high-voltage cable, adjust the position of the movable end on the horizontal ruler horizontally so that the elastic rod coincides with the bending degree of the high-voltage cable, and read on the horizontal ruler The turning radius of the cable can be directly obtained from the scale at the intersection point with the moving end of the elastic rod. The measurement method is simple and the measurement range is wide. the
